AI wave just beginning according to Nvidia and Suriname can ride along

The nervousness surrounding artificial intelligence in the stock market got no confirmation from Jensen Huang, as Nvidia's top executive calls the AI wave only the beginning of a new industrial revolution and envisions a three- to four-trillion-dollar infrastructure market toward the end of the decade. His optimism does clash with the cool reception on Wall Street, as the outlook for the current quarter, while above consensus, did not surprise enough to justify the recent share price violence.

The chip designer reckons third-quarter sales of $54 billion with a range of two percent, while in the previous quarter $46.74 billion came in, and especially the data center business remained the focus. Uncertainty about China weighs into the estimate, as Nvidia assumes zero sales of the H20 chip in that country, although if geopolitics relaxes, an additional two to five billion dollars could still be added. Meanwhile, interest outside China appears vital, including a single $650 million order for H20, and Nvidia announced another $60 billion in additional share repurchases.

The company continues to float on large buyers among hyperscalers and governments, with the top financial woman pointing to an expected revenue of twenty billion dollars from so-called sovereign-AI projects this year. Huang keeps the horizon even wider, estimating that cloud and enterprise customers are already heading toward six hundred billion dollars in AI-related spending this year, with the total investment picture rising to three to four trillion dollars by 2030. At the same time, analysts see the first signs that major cloud players are timing their spending a bit more precisely now that revenues from AI applications are not immediately visible everywhere.

By starting with targeted training in data engineering, energy efficient refrigeration, coding and network management, and by choosing only projects that demonstrably deliver value, Suriname can turn its productivity into sustainable income, those who sharpen their skillset thereby lift the economy and Suriname can keep up with these AI developments.
